pretty Christmas design the vellum is a perfect cover to your background, next time cut it a bit larger and glued it on the backside from your paper then you can't see the adhesive, or another tip cut your red strips a bit longer and let them overlap to glue on the back, they would keep your vellum in place too, any way I didn't notice the adhesive and I love your pretty poinsettia

I just love the softness the vellum adds here Jen and the shaping one way to do it is to run a stylus tool on the back side where the veins are and it will give the leaves and petals a crease. (gently) can wrap the cardstock around your finger too.
